Facts of the Case

Background

Applicant obtained Supreme Court judgment for USD41,161.30 against first respondent, issued writs of execution, attached immovable property; High Court suspended sale in execution pending determination of whether judgment debt had been discharged; applicant sought direct access to Constitutional Court alleging violation of her right to protection of the law under s 56(1) of Constitution.
